Tampa Marriott Water Street

700 S Florida Ave
Tampa, Florida
See map below for directions from Tampa Marriott Water Street to Florida Aquarium (0.6 miles)

Check room rates and availability

Book a room at
TAMPA MARRIOTT WATER STREET